On Tue, 27 April 2010 13:31:11 +0200, Paolo Minazzi wrote:
>
> > If you add "rootfstype=romfs" to the command line, does the problem
> > still exist?
>
> Jorn , you are right.
> It seems work....
> please wait....
Ok, I'm pretty sure that logfs returns -EIO where it should return
-EINVAL. If filesystems are tried in alphabetical order, logfs comes
first and -EIO tells the kernel to stop trying and panic, essentially.
Will cook up a patch...
